999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

計算機軟件JAVA編程優勢及其應用研究

2019-01-30 04:47:23吳文慶
職業技術 2019年7期
關鍵詞:計算機軟件優勢特征

吳文慶

(蘇州市職業大學計算機工程學院,江蘇 蘇州 215104)

0 引言

JAVA編程屬于一種使用比較頻繁的編程技術,其在操作過程中涉及類庫、關鍵字、語句、語言規則等內容。通過總結各種實踐經驗能夠看出,利用高效的開發技術能夠促進計算機軟件運行效率的有效提高,為此通過研究JAVA編程語言,能夠有效簡化軟件開發中的界面設計、操作、傳輸等過程,提高計算機軟件的整體質量和開發效率。

1 計算機軟件JAVA編程優勢特征

計算機軟件JAVA編程具備多方面優勢特征,包括直接性優勢特征、獨立性優勢特征、安全性優勢特征、便攜移植性優勢特征、結構簡單性特征、可拓展性特征。

1.1 直接性優勢特征

JAVA編程中的直接性優勢其實就是指其在開發軟件時,能夠直接面向對象。軟件程序編寫過程中,假如立足整體角度進行編寫,就會無法有效把握編程質量和編程效率,提高整體工作量。為此相關編程人員也提出了在計算機程序變成模塊化的基礎上再進行編制。通過這種方式能夠根據相應的步驟和計劃組織多位編程人員共同參與同一個軟件編寫工作。而在JAVA編程語言中,具有直接面向對象的設計優勢,滿足模塊化編程的基本要求,也就是通過JAVA編程語言中不同的功能,根據相應的程序功能,在編程過程中實現模塊劃分,從而方便后續軟件維護和編程工作的順利進行。

1.2 獨立性優勢特征

JAVA編程語言的代表優勢之一就是其中的平臺獨立性特征,JAVA虛擬機是JAVA編程語言的理念指導,首先是將其編譯成一種中間碼,隨后進行裝載工作與校驗工作,隨后通過計算機中的機器碼不斷執行實現任務。因此可以將平臺環境中的所有內部特性要求全部屏蔽在外,在現實運行過程中,只要能夠支持JAVA虛擬機,就能夠促進JAVA編程程序的有效運行。

1.3 安全性優勢特征

JAVA編程中的公共密鑰技術屬于一種確定技術,可以全面展示出指示器的操作流程,在指示器出現變化時,程序也會對訪問的私有數據進行全面限制,從而提高數據系統的安全性,幫助數據信息屏蔽各種病毒的侵害,保護計算機系統安全。此外,利用JAVA編程語言進行設計,能夠靈活適應多變的網絡環境,維護用戶的正常操作,提高軟件擴展性和靈活性。將JAVA編程語言有效應用于計算機軟件設計過程中,能夠更好地保護計算機的安全運行,為其操作過程提供可靠的保障。

1.4 便攜移植性優勢特征

在計算機軟件編程工作中,不可避免地會遇到一些需要進行修改的問題,如果在修改過程中采用了不同的編制語言方法,則容易導致計算機程序的設計研發出現一定的延遲或者偏差。這種情況下,使用Java編程語言可以利用Java編程本身具有的便攜移植性優勢,在遇到需要修改的情況時,編程人員可以直接在固有的程序構架基礎上,根據實際情況做出相應的改變。比如:在應用商店中,用戶可以根據自身的實際需求選擇相應的軟件,而Java編程的運用使得用戶不再受下載類型的限制,為用戶順利完成下載提供保障[1]。

1.5 結構簡單性特征

相較于傳統的C++語言,Java編程語言在運算符重裁、自動強制方面具備顯著優勢,這使得JAVA編程可更好滿足計算機軟件開發村鎮的各項實質需求,開發環節混淆現象的發生也能夠得到較好控制。Java編程語言在使用中可將源代碼轉換為二進制節碼,這使得其能夠較好服務于不同平臺的代碼編寫,編程工作的難度可由此大幅下降,配合其具備的自動收集清理內存空間垃圾功能,Java編程語言的應用可進一步優化計算機軟件開發工作流程,計算機軟件的總體實用性也能夠得到更好保障。

2 計算機軟件JAVA編程相關技術

JAVA Database Connectivity 技術、JAVA Remote Method Invocation 技術均屬于計算機軟件JAVA編程技術典型,具體技術應用如下:

2.1 JAVA Database Connectivity 技術

JAVA Database Connectivity 這一技術在計算機軟件開發與設計中的應用,其作用主要體現在可以實現多種關系數據之間的相互訪問,在為不同數據庫之間提供有效連接方式的基礎上,借助JAVA編程語言,也可以進一步提升數據庫的應用效果。在具體的應用操作中,JAVA編程語言在對數據庫的連接方式進行相應的編譯與調試之后,可以促進后臺數據庫體系管理的進一步完善和優化,從而為計算機程序整體的高效、穩定運行提供強有力的技術支持與數據支持,對于構建完善、有效的數據庫連接工具具有不可忽視的重要意義。JAVA Annotation 技術在計算機技術水平不斷提升的社會背景下,計算機軟件開發設計過程中編程語言的重要性逐漸突顯出來,而JAVA編程語言憑借本身具有的多種優勢特征,使其可以在計算機編程領域當中占據重要的地位。JAVA Annotation 技術是計算機JAVA編程語言中常用的一類技術手段,這類技術在JAVA編程中的應用,可以有效實現JAVA編程語言參數、類別、屬性和變量幾者之間的聯系,對于促進機制整合發揮著積極的作用[2]。

2.2 JAVA Remote Method Invocation 技術

計算機的軟件開發過程中JAVA 編程語言的應用優勢體現在多個方面,包括嵌入式應用優勢、直接性應用優勢、便攜移植性應用優勢、安全性應用優勢等。其中JAVA Remote Method Invocation(Java遠程方法調用)技術的應用,在很大程度上提升了應用管理工作效率。在具體的應用程序管理工作中,一般是通過采用分布式管理方式實現,同時通過對JAVA Remote Method Invocation相關技術的合理化運用,使得服務器與客戶兩者之間的程序運行效率得到大幅度提高。比如:借助,JAVA 編程語言中的相關技術,將一類網絡游戲在手機等終端上顯現出啦,在確保游戲完整性的同時,保證了人們的應用效果。為了最大程度上保證應用程序開發的合理性,充分整合JAVA 編程語言相關技術資源信息,對于有效維護計算機應用程序的安全性和完整性具有重要意義。

3 計算機軟件JAVA編程的應用方式

3.1 計算機軟件JAVA編程的嵌入式應用

國內計算機軟件設計與實際應用過程中,嵌入式系統設備作為重要的組成部分,是計算機軟件開發設計的關鍵性、實用設備,其核心作用是保證計算機軟件的實際應用效果。通常情況下,嵌入式系統設備本身的硬件與軟件可以通過剪裁法完成對應的加工工作,但是在具體的應用過程中對于自身體積和功能消耗有著較高的要求。計算機軟件開發過程中,靈活應用Java編程相關技術手段,可以支持嵌入式系統快速完成一系列指標,提升計算機軟件開發工作效果[3]。從現階段我國計算機軟件開發工程的實際情況來看,出于對嵌入式系統設備自身嚴格要求的考慮,會對計算機軟件的運行壽命進行相應的縮減,這種做法對于嵌入式系統整個的應用效果是非常不利的。

3.2 Java編程在計算機無線與移動工作中的應用

在Nokia不斷推動的影響下,我國Java編程在計算機無線與移動工作中的應用范圍逐漸擴大,同時Java編程在多個領域中的應用也逐漸獲得更高的認可。在計算機軟件開發設計工作中,Java編程無線項目本身的地位得到顯著的提升,并且隨著移動互聯網發展速度的不斷加快,眾多移動設備生產廠家在具體的運營生產過程中逐漸提高了對Java編程技術的重視,將Java編程技術靈活應用到各個環節的設計與開發工作中。在未來一段時間的發展中,移動設備的創新發展勢必會促進開放源代碼相關操作系統與Java編程兩者的相互結合,從而共同開創一個全新的移動設備市場環境。近年來,國內的Java編程技術水平不斷提升,相關應用體系也得到了不斷的優化和完善,在很大程度上為我國移動生產商對于Java編程相關應用程序的速度、寬帶和負載均衡等性能進行了創新與規劃,從而使得Java編程技術應用過程存在的讀寫問題得到有效解決。

3.3 計算機軟件JAVA編程在企業與行業中的應用

隨著Java編程技術的不斷創新發展,計算機軟件Java編程在企業與行業中也逐漸得到廣泛的應用。比如:當前常見的SUN、BEA和IBM等一些知名生產廠家,便借助計算機軟件Java編程技術推出一系列應用軟件和服務器,Java編程技術的知名度得到很大的提升。近年來,在經濟金融、科技研發、電子以及工業制造等行業或者領域中應用范圍的不斷擴大,使得Java編程技術的慢性編程成為帶動國內經濟發展的重要因素,而將Java編程技術應用到多個不同領域中已經是非常普遍的現象[4]。比如:高等教育院校計算機專業教學中,Java編程技術這類具有較強實用性的軟件得到了關注,借助Java編程計算機軟件平臺促進高校計算機專業教學質量和教學效率的提升。

4 計算機軟件JAVA編程的具體應用

為直觀展示計算機軟件JAVA編程的具體應用,本文選擇了圖形化編程工具軟件作為研究對象,具體應用如下:

4.1 設計流程

以圖形化編程工具軟件為例,該軟件基于Eclipse平臺,該平臺則以Java編程語言為基礎。圖形化編程工具軟件由三個模塊組成,包括圖形轉換器、語言編譯器、圖形信號轉碼器,通過提供的背景模型,即可應用圖形化編程工具軟件完成圖形編程,這里的背景模型可以是存儲的信息,也可以是轉換圖形編輯設計的信息,配合由代碼轉換器生成的文本,Java編程語言便能夠較好服務于圖形化編程工具軟件,最終完成編譯器轉換。

4.2 語言基礎

通過應用師元建模機制,圖形編程語言設計可在Java編程語言的支持下完成計算機軟件的設計,其可用于描述一些較為抽象的語法和語義,區分具體語法和抽象語法,對抽象語法的擴展過程實質上即為具體語法,元模型的關聯約束和基本元素均能夠在Java編程語言的支持下通過特定的圖形符號反映出來。

4.3 JAVA圖形編輯器設計

基于MVC構架的JAVA圖形編輯器設計可實現圍繞應用程序分析層、表現層、控制層的分析,并實現3種層次的獨立演化,其本質上屬于軟件處理問題過程中的內在抽象。對于程序問題的數據邏輯關系處理,JAVA圖形編輯器可通過封裝的方式較好解決,以設計視圖的過程為例,如用戶需要實現圖形更改,在JAVA圖形編輯器支持下,其必須將語言元模型中的元素轉換為特定圖形符號,這一過程需得到相應的圖形符號支持。對于設計模型,JAVA圖形編輯器需要為每個視圖創建相應模型,并保存圖形的相關代碼。從控制器設計角度來說,控制器在控模型對象時負責視圖和模型的協調,每個控制器均可以是監聽器實現的接口,控制器也可以在相應的模型對象內作為監聽器保留,如出現模型對象數據更改,根據數據,控制器可更改創建新視圖,或根據視圖選擇有效的位置和大小,以此保證模型和視圖能夠保持一致。此外,在接受編輯和反饋結果層面,JAVA圖形編輯器還需要配備編輯策略類功能,以此保證控制器能夠生成刪除語句的命令類對象,客戶的需求可由此得到更好滿足,在通知相關控制器后,前臺視圖的刷新可由編輯器的應用實現。

4.4 設計代碼轉換器

在應用Java編程語言設計代碼轉換器過程中,需得到相應的翻譯軟件支持,翻譯的實現應以代碼模板機制為基礎,以此實現JAVA編程語言的文本代碼兼容。通過劃分文本代碼內容,即可將其細分為主體框架和局部細節,通過為各個元素配置對應的翻譯軟件,元素的實例即會在翻譯完成后轉化為相應的JAVA代碼字符串。

5 結語

隨著科技的進步和網絡的普及,人們對于計算機軟件內性能與功能的要求也不斷提高,在這種時代背景下,計算機軟件設計人員應該合理選擇編程語言,提高軟件設計質量。利用JAVA編程語言,能夠通過其技術優勢降低軟件編程難度,提高計算機軟件的安全性與可靠性,從而在滿足客戶要求的基礎上,促進計算機軟件綜合效益的持續提升。

猜你喜歡
計算機軟件優勢特征
矮的優勢
趣味(語文)(2020年3期)2020-07-27 01:42:46
如何表達“特征”
不忠誠的四個特征
當代陜西(2019年10期)2019-06-03 10:12:04
基于C語言的計算機軟件編程
電子制作(2018年16期)2018-09-26 03:27:08
淺談不同編程語言對計算機軟件開發的影響
電子制作(2018年1期)2018-04-04 01:48:36
抓住特征巧觀察
畫與話
淺談基于C語言的計算機軟件程序設計
電子制作(2017年24期)2017-02-02 07:14:40
談“五老”的五大特殊優勢
中國火炬(2014年11期)2014-07-25 10:31:58
線性代數的應用特征
河南科技(2014年23期)2014-02-27 14:19:15
主站蜘蛛池模板: 国产精品私拍在线爆乳| 日本日韩欧美| 高清精品美女在线播放| 国产av色站网站| 思思热在线视频精品| 国产精品专区第1页| 青青草原偷拍视频| 国内精自视频品线一二区| 日日碰狠狠添天天爽| 日韩精品专区免费无码aⅴ| 92精品国产自产在线观看| 亚洲欧美成人综合| 欧美一区二区福利视频| 91福利国产成人精品导航| 免费国产无遮挡又黄又爽| 国产国拍精品视频免费看| 九色在线视频导航91| 久操中文在线| 亚洲国产清纯| 欧美a级在线| 国产欧美日韩另类| 一级毛片高清| 日本成人在线不卡视频| 高清免费毛片| 国产女人水多毛片18| 这里只有精品在线播放| 国产成人欧美| 国产亚洲成AⅤ人片在线观看| 亚洲人免费视频| 国产一区二区人大臿蕉香蕉| h视频在线播放| 日韩视频精品在线| 午夜高清国产拍精品| 91香蕉视频下载网站| 伊人成人在线视频| 中文字幕第4页| 99热这里只有成人精品国产| 亚洲日本中文字幕天堂网| 97在线碰| 一级毛片在线免费看| 国产第四页| 亚洲福利视频网址| 日韩黄色大片免费看| 久综合日韩| 亚洲成av人无码综合在线观看| 日本久久网站| 日韩精品无码免费一区二区三区 | 中文字幕永久在线看| 亚洲欧美不卡视频| 亚洲自拍另类| 黄色网页在线播放| 性视频久久| 熟妇人妻无乱码中文字幕真矢织江 | 久一在线视频| 国产无套粉嫩白浆| 久无码久无码av无码| 免费欧美一级| 久草美女视频| 欧美成人国产| 久久这里只精品热免费99| 国产精品自在在线午夜| 久久一日本道色综合久久| 九九热精品视频在线| 亚洲无线一二三四区男男| 麻豆精品视频在线原创| 97se亚洲| 亚洲精品视频免费观看| 国产精品 欧美激情 在线播放| jizz在线观看| 免费一级全黄少妇性色生活片| 久久国产精品电影| 亚洲色欲色欲www网| 欧美久久网| 在线看片中文字幕| 国产区福利小视频在线观看尤物| 亚洲人成色在线观看| 青草娱乐极品免费视频| 91麻豆精品国产高清在线| 亚洲午夜片| 日韩在线1| 91精品免费高清在线| 一级毛片在线直接观看|